Capacity is a maximum, not a comfort rating
Some 1–2 person cabins are comfortable for one adult and close for two. Compare interior width, bench length, glass and heater intrusion, and each user’s shoulder width. If possible, tape the interior bench dimensions on a wall or bench at home.
A larger cabin can change warm-up and power
More air and surface area may require more heater output or time. Yet two products with the same capacity label can have different wattage and radiant coverage. Compare actual specifications.
When one person is the right answer
Choose the compact model when the delivery route, floor area, or budget leaves little margin and sessions will nearly always be solo. Keep enough surrounding room for door swing, vents, assembly, and service.
